Essential Travel Guide for North America from Portugal
Preparing for a trip across the Atlantic requires careful planning. Understanding these practical aspects ensures a smooth journey from Portugal to the diverse landscapes of the North American continent.
Portuguese citizens traveling to the USA for tourism or business usually require an ESTA (Electronic System for Travel Authorization) rather than a traditional visa. This must be applied for online at least 72 hours before departure. For Canada, a similar Electronic Travel Authorization (eTA) is mandatory for air travelers. If you are visiting Mexico, Portuguese passport holders typically do not need a visa for short stays but must complete a Multiple Immigration Form (FMM). Always ensure your passport is valid for at least six months beyond your planned stay. Keep digital and physical copies of these documents, as airlines will verify them at check-in in Lisbon or Porto. Requirements can change, so checking official government portals shortly before your flight is a vital step for every traveler.
North America is vast, and transportation methods vary significantly by region. In major cities like New York, Chicago, or Mexico City, extensive subway systems make car rentals unnecessary. However, for exploring national parks or traveling between smaller towns, renting a car is often essential. Unlike the dense rail network in Portugal, passenger trains in the USA and Canada are limited and can be expensive. For long distances, domestic flights are the most common choice. Ride-sharing apps are ubiquitous and often more convenient than traditional taxis. If you plan to drive, a valid Portuguese license is usually sufficient, but an International Driving Permit is recommended for clarity. Remember that distances are much larger than in Europe; a 'short drive' on a map can easily take several hours on the highway.
Lodging options in North America range from budget motels to luxury high-rise hotels. In the USA and Canada, quoted prices often exclude local taxes and resort fees, which are added at checkout. This differs from Portugal, where the displayed price usually includes VAT. Motels are a practical, cost-effective choice for road trips, offering basic amenities and free parking. In urban centers, boutique hotels and short-term rentals are popular but require early booking. For a unique experience, consider staying in historic inns in New England or eco-lodges in the Canadian Rockies. Always check if breakfast is included, as many North American hotels charge extra for it. Using a credit card is standard for check-in deposits. If traveling during peak summer or holiday periods, booking several months in advance is necessary to secure reasonable rates.
North America is generally safe for travelers, but standard urban precautions apply. In large cities, stay aware of your surroundings and keep valuables out of sight, especially in crowded tourist areas. Common scams include unofficial taxis at airports or individuals offering 'help' at ticket machines. In the USA, be mindful of the high cost of healthcare; comprehensive travel insurance is mandatory for Portuguese travelers to avoid astronomical bills in case of injury. When visiting natural areas, follow all wildlife safety guidelines, particularly regarding bears in the north. Unlike the relatively predictable weather in Portugal, North America can experience extreme conditions like hurricanes or blizzards. Sign up for local weather alerts. Generally, local police are helpful and professional. If you ever feel unsafe, seek out a well-lit public space or enter a shop to ask for assistance.
Cultural norms in North America may differ from Portugal, particularly regarding service. In the USA and Canada, tipping is not optional; it is a standard part of the service industry wage. A tip of 18% to 22% is expected at restaurants, while bartenders and taxi drivers also expect a gratuity. In Mexico, tipping is also customary but usually at a slightly lower percentage. Social interactions are often more informal and direct than in Europe. Punctuality is highly valued for business and social appointments. When visiting indigenous lands or religious sites, follow posted rules regarding photography and behavior. To explore like a local, visit neighborhood diners or community farmers' markets rather than just the main tourist plazas. This 'don't be a tourist' approach allows you to experience the genuine hospitality and diverse cultural heritage that defines the continent's various regions.
